I produced a planetary image simulation for the thin mirror. It is here:
http://www.visi.com/~mkoehler/eason_davis_misc/davis_jupiter.png
I assumed a central obstruction of 20%, which is probably the best you
can do for an f/3.5. In the second and third frames, I correct the
mirror for spherical aberration and then for primary astigmatism (much
easier to do in software than in reality).
Unfortunately, I am unable to do a simulation for a low-power image of
the full moon. It would be interesting to see what the large craters
look like in a low-power view.
